The CFD Cyclone Feeder Duty Pump is a high-performance industrial solution specifically engineered to handle the most severe slurry applications. Designed for maximum durability in mineral processing plants, this pump excels in managing large-size particles within dense abrasive slurries, making it the ideal choice for ball and SAG mill cyclone feed, as well as water-flush crushing operations.

Backed by over 25 years of fundamental research and rigorous field trials, the CFD series integrates advanced hard alloy and elastomer technologies. Its unique interchangeable material system allows operators to customize the pump with all-metal, all-rubber, or hybrid linings, ensuring balanced wear characteristics and optimal efficiency tailored to the specific demands of copper, gold, and coal mining environments.

Key Advantages

Extreme Wear Resistance

Utilizes the latest hard alloy and elastomer technology to extend service life in highly corrosive and abrasive environments.

Optimized Maintenance

Fast one-piece wet-end changeout on larger sizes ensures minimal downtime during critical maintenance cycles.

Reduced Recirculation

Deep expelling vanes on hard alloy impellers significantly reduce recirculation, boosting overall pumping efficiency.

Vortex Suppression

Patented extended shroud feature traps tip vortices to prevent localized scouring on the throatbush face.

Structural Integrity

The split outer casing maintains safety and high operating pressure even when internal liners are fully worn.

Material Flexibility

Only manufacturer offering interchangeable materials across a wide range of alloys and moulded elastomers.

Frequently Asked Questions

Q: What makes the CFD pump suitable for SAG mill cyclone feed?

The CFD pump is specifically designed for severe applications, utilizing large-diameter, low-speed impellers and advanced hard alloys to handle the high-density, large-particle abrasive slurries typically found in SAG mill circuits.

Q: Can I mix metal and rubber liners in one CFD pump?

Yes, the CFD is the only pump for mill circuit applications that offers the flexibility of all-metal, all-rubber, or a combination of both, allowing you to balance wear characteristics for each component.

Q: How does the patented extended shroud feature help?

The extended shroud traps tip vortices, which minimizes turbulence at the expelling vane tips and prevents localized scouring on the throatbush face, thereby extending the life of the wet-end.

Q: Is the CFD pump compatible with coarse coal cyclone feed?

Absolutely. The CFD series is highly suitable for arduous slurry transfer applications, including gravel dredging and coarse coal cyclone feed in coal washing plants.

Q: What happens when the internal liners are fully worn?

Because of the split outer casing design, the pump maintains its structural integrity and high operating pressure capability, ensuring safety even when internal liners have reached the end of their life.

Q: Is reverse rotation possible for special sump orientations?

Yes, reverse rotation options are available to minimize wear in special sump orientations, providing additional flexibility for complex plant layouts.
